  • LOL Nevada bases theirs on vehicle MSRP and age so you get wildly different registrations. My wife’s 1972 GMC C1500 is $35/year. My 1977 Mercedes Benz 6.9 was (RIP) $55/year. My 2021 base model Nissan Leaf was ~$250/year. My Subaru Ascent was ~$550/year. My 2021 Mustang Mach E GTPE was >$800 this year - almost $900.

    I would be okay paying up to a $200/year surcharge. We have no income tax in Nevada, generally low taxes all around, and I don’t pay any fuel taxes as we have a Bolt EUV and Mach E now and we only take the C1500 a few times a year. I have no problem contributing to the roads.


  • I can tell you why my wife and I didn’t buy an ID4 as well as an Ioniq 5 (different reasons).

    First, the Ioniq 5 was great but the dealer wasn’t. 29 sitting on the lot, all with a $5,000-$10,000 markup. Wouldn’t let us test drive. Test drove a used one at another dealership but then they tried to change the price and increase it when we showed interest.

    Now, the ID4 was a whole experience. First off, it was a disappointing driving experience. Compared to the Ioniq 5 it felt sluggish. Additionally the sale person was straight up being dishonest about tax credits with him and his manager saying everything was eligible. I pulled vins from their site and at the time not a single vehicle on their lot was eligible.

    Ended up getting a Mach E below market value.
